{ "flamebearer": { "names": [ "total", "threading.py:930 - _bootstrap", "threading.py:973 - _bootstrap_inner", "threading.py:910 - run", "threadloop/threadloop.py:78 - _start_io_loop", "tornado/platform/asyncio.py:199 - start", "asyncio/base_events.py:596 - run_forever", "asyncio/base_events.py:1891 - _run_once", "asyncio/events.py:80 - _run", "tornado/ioloop.py:688 - \u003clambda\u003e", "tornado/ioloop.py:741 - _run_callback", "tornado/gen.py:814 - inner", "tornado/gen.py:775 - run", "tornado/gen.py:818 - handle_yield", "asyncio/base_events.py:1890 - _run_once", "tornado/gen.py:769 - run", "jaeger_client/reporter.py:168 - _consume_queue", "tornado/gen.py:234 - wrapper", "jaeger_client/reporter.py:194 - _submit", "tornado/gen.py:216 - wrapper", "jaeger_client/reporter.py:211 - _send", "jaeger_client/thrift_gen/agent/Agent.py:99 - emitBatch", "jaeger_client/thrift_gen/agent/Agent.py:108 - send_emitBatch", "thrift/transport/TTransport.py:179 - flush", "jaeger_client/TUDPTransport.py:41 - write", "jaeger_client/thrift_gen/agent/Agent.py:266 - write", "jaeger_client/thrift_gen/jaeger/ttypes.py:797 - write", "jaeger_client/thrift_gen/jaeger/ttypes.py:588 - write", "thrift/protocol/TCompactProtocol.py:42 - nested", "thrift/protocol/TCompactProtocol.py:283 - __writeBinary", "thrift/protocol/TCompactProtocol.py:220 - __writeSize", "thrift/protocol/TCompactProtocol.py:154 - __writeVarint", "thrift/protocol/TCompactProtocol.py:64 - writeVarint", "jaeger_client/thrift_gen/agent/Agent.py:106 - send_emitBatch", "jaeger_client/thrift_gen/agent/Agent.py:263 - write", "thrift/protocol/TCompactProtocol.py:229 - writeCollectionBegin", "jaeger_client/thrift_gen/jaeger/ttypes.py:151 - write", "thrift/protocol/TCompactProtocol.py:179 - writeStructBegin", "jaeger_client/thrift_gen/jaeger/ttypes.py:555 - write", "thrift/protocol/TCompactProtocol.py:70 - writeVarint", "asyncio/selector_events.py:120 - _read_from_self", "flask/app.py:2088 - __call__", "flask/app.py:2070 - wsgi_app", "flask/app.py:1516 - full_dispatch_request", "flask/app.py:1499 - dispatch_request", "services/driver/server.py:25 - find_nearest", "flask/json/__init__.py:347 - jsonify", "werkzeug/local.py:430 - __get__", "werkzeug/local.py:544 - _get_current_object", "flask/globals.py:48 - _find_app", "werkzeug/local.py:247 - top", "werkzeug/local.py:153 - __getattr__", "flask/app.py:1513 - full_dispatch_request", "services/driver/server.py:32 - handle_find_nearest", "services/driver/server.py:30 - \u003clistcomp\u003e", "services/driver/redis.py:13 - get_driver", "asyncio/events.py:95 - _run", "tornado/ioloop.py:761 - _run_callback", "tornado/gen.py:792 - run", "tornado/gen.py:254 - wrapper", "tornado/gen.py:741 - __init__", "tornado/gen.py:780 - run", "jaeger_client/reporter.py:195 - _submit" ], "levels": [ [0, 8159, 0, 0], [0, 1, 0, 7, 0, 2, 0, 41, 0, 8156, 0, 1], [0, 1, 0, 7, 0, 2, 0, 42, 0, 8156, 0, 2], [0, 1, 0, 56, 0, 1, 0, 52, 0, 1, 0, 43, 0, 8156, 0, 3], [0, 1, 0, 9, 0, 1, 0, 44, 0, 1, 0, 44, 0, 8156, 0, 4], [0, 1, 0, 57, 0, 1, 0, 45, 0, 1, 0, 45, 0, 8156, 0, 5], [0, 1, 0, 11, 0, 1, 0, 53, 0, 1, 0, 46, 0, 8156, 0, 6], [0, 1, 0, 58, 0, 1, 0, 54, 0, 1, 0, 47, 0, 8155, 0, 14, 0, 1, 0, 7], [0, 1, 0, 7, 0, 1, 1, 55, 0, 1, 0, 48, 0, 8155, 0, 8, 0, 1, 0, 8], [0, 1, 0, 56, 1, 1, 0, 49, 0, 465, 465, 40, 0, 7690, 0, 9, 0, 1, 0, 9], [0, 1, 0, 9, 1, 1, 0, 50, 465, 7690, 0, 10, 0, 1, 0, 10], [0, 1, 0, 57, 1, 1, 1, 51, 465, 7690, 0, 11, 0, 1, 0, 11], [0, 1, 0, 11, 467, 7690, 0, 15, 0, 1, 0, 12], [0, 1, 0, 58, 467, 7690, 0, 16, 0, 1, 1, 13], [0, 1, 0, 7, 467, 7690, 0, 17], [0, 1, 0, 56, 467, 7690, 0, 18], [0, 1, 0, 9, 467, 7690, 0, 19], [0, 1, 0, 57, 467, 7690, 0, 20], [0, 1, 0, 11, 467, 7690, 0, 21], [0, 1, 0, 59, 467, 3, 0, 33, 0, 7687, 0, 22], [0, 1, 0, 60, 467, 3, 0, 34, 0, 1, 0, 25, 0, 7686, 0, 23], [0, 1, 0, 61, 467, 3, 0, 26, 0, 1, 0, 26, 0, 7686, 7686, 24], [0, 1, 1, 62, 467, 1, 0, 38, 0, 1, 0, 27, 0, 1, 1, 35, 0, 1, 0, 27], [468, 1, 0, 28, 0, 1, 0, 36, 1, 1, 0, 28], [468, 1, 0, 29, 0, 1, 1, 37, 1, 1, 0, 29], [468, 1, 0, 30, 2, 1, 0, 30], [468, 1, 0, 31, 2, 1, 0, 31], [468, 1, 1, 39, 2, 1, 1, 32] ], "numTicks": 8159, "maxSelf": 7686, "spyName": "pyspy", "sampleRate": 100, "units": "samples", "format": "single" }, "metadata": { "format": "single", "sampleRate": 100, "spyName": "pyspy", "units": "samples" }, "timeline": { "startTime": 1634591500, "samples": [2405, 2168, 1761, 1829], "durationDelta": 10 }, "groups": {} }